#3d53b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d53bb is composed of 23.9% red, 32.5%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#3d53bb color hex could be obtained by blending #7aa6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3d53b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d53bb has RGB values of R:61, G:83,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4019131.

Shades and Tints of #3d53b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040a is the darkest color, while #fafaf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d53b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767882 is the less saturated color, while #042ef4 is the most saturated one.
